What is Shake the Dust about?
"Shake the Dust" is a powerful documentary that takes you on a journey to the streets of Uganda, Yemen, and Cambodia, where breakdancing has become a symbol of hope and resilience. Despite being separated by cultural and geographical boundaries, these three communities are united by their passion for dance and hip-hop culture. The film celebrates the global reach of hip-hop and its ability to bring people together, highlighting the similarities that connect us all. Through stunning visuals and inspiring stories, "Shake the Dust" shows how dance can transcend borders and bring people together in a way that nothing else can.
